How to Optimize Your Google Business Listing

As we all know Google Business Listing (GMB) doesn’t cause even a penny! This free tool helps business owners manage their online presence across the search engine. Creating a GMB profile is the initial step to local search success.GMB offers great benefits for the brands looking for local exposure. Below are some important information that you must optimise in your GMB listing.

Business Name:- The smartest way is to keep the business name consistent with what is currently listed on your website. 

Business category:- The category you pick is what defines your organisation and introduces you to clients who are looking for the services you provide. You should consider a keyword strategy approach when adding a business category. Because category is also a factor that affects the local ranking on Google. 

Description:- Google shows only the first 250 characters of the description in the knowledge panel of GMB, thus prioritize the information accordingly. The description should be impressive to your customers and also don’t forget to add your keywords in the description.

Upload better images:-  Google itself mentioned that the ‘Businesses with photos are more likely to receive requests for driving directions to their location, as well as clicks through to their websites, than businesses that don’t have photos’. There are three types of photos that you can add to your Google business. That is Logo, cover photos and additional photos. So what’s waiting for? Upload the high quality images to your GMB!

Get google reviews and Respond to your Reviews –   If you were to receive a list of businesses in search results, which one would you be most likely to choose? The one with more attractive yellow stars or one with no reviews at all? Yes, Obviously the one with more yellow stars!  So, The more you have the ratings, the more chance you will get noticed. Responding to the reviews will encourage the new customers to leave reviews for you.

Add your products to GMB – You can add your products through the Products tab in your Google My Business dashboard. This will make sure all customers search on the computer or a mobile device see the products you are offering.

Add the latest update post to GMB – What’s New post section in GMB is great for sharing general business updates, latest activities at the company, blog posts and more. Also, GMB has a new type of post designed for announcements related to COVID-19. Some examples of such announcements are temporary closures, new operating hours, changes to regular service and more.
